I signed up for the free month trial of Apple news service. I am a bit
baffled regarding the list of magazines. I know it’s only the first day
this is out, so perhaps not too many have signed up for it yet. But I don’t
understand why it would appear that I am not seeing the full list of
magazines. When I go to the end of the very long list, I’m stopped in the
case of my iPhone ex are with Southern living being the last magazine.
They are in alphabetical order. On my 7+, which I updated first, I got as
far as sunset magazine, which should come just after Southern living I
guess, and no more. I do not see the Wall Street Journal listed, although
it is a newspaper technically and not a magazine. Same for the Los
Angeles times. I can’t see articles from those papers, but not the whole
paper. I was under the impression that we were going to get access to the
entire thing. The magazines look like the full deal. But those papers are
not in the listing. I wonder what I’m missing. It looks quite accessible.
When you double tap on a magazine title, it downloads and you can see the
full listing of the titles of articles and features. Then you double tap
on one and you go there. So that part looks good. But I’m just not
understanding where are the rest of the magazines. Nothing beginning with
T through Z?
